Steps to reproduce

Look for extension you want to install then tap download/install.

Expected behavior

The extension to be installed.

Actual behavior

But it will load for a second then go back to the download button and the extension being unable to be installed.

Crash logs

No response

Aniyomi version

preview r7509

Android version

android 14

Device

Redmi k20 pro

Other details

I have also tried to install normal aniyomi version and app like mihon which is like tachiyomi and they do the same thing. Maybe an issue with android version. Will wait for a fix.

try turning off miui optimizations or use different installer in more - settings - advanced - installer and if it's only about manga/external extensions then already reported in #1450
